+ 2

how to connect DB2 with Python

required information how to connect a windows based DB2 system with python. I need to create a repository of tables with an online screen. any help really appreciated

14th Mar 2018, 3:17 PM
Arun Chiriyankandath
Arun Chiriyankandath - avatar
1 Resposta
+ 2
>>> import DB2 >>> conn = DB2.connect(dsn='sample', uid='db2inst1', pwd='******') >>> curs = conn.cursor() >>> curs.execute('SELECT * FROM ORG') >>> rows = curs.fetchall() >>> rows [('A00', 'SPIFFY COMPUTER SERVICE DIV.', '000010', 'A00', None), ('B01', 'PLANNING', '000020', 'A00', None), ('C01', 'INFORMATION CENTER', '000030', 'A00', None), ('D01', 'DEVELOPMENT CENTER', None, 'A00', None), ('D11', 'MANUFACTURING SYSTEMS', '000060', 'D01', None), ('D21', 'ADMINISTRATION SYSTEMS', '000070', 'D01', None), ('E01', 'SUPPORT SERVICES', '000050', 'A00', None), ('E11', 'OPERATIONS', '000090', 'E01', None), ('E21', 'SOFTWARE SUPPORT', '000100', 'E01', None), ('F22', 'BRANCH OFFICE F2', None, 'E01', None), ('G22', 'BRANCH OFFICE G2', None, 'E01', None), ('H22', 'BRANCH OFFICE H2', None, 'E01', None), ('I22', 'BRANCH OFFICE I2', None, 'E01', None), ('J22', 'BRANCH OFFICE J2', None, 'E01', None)] >>> curs.close() >>> conn.close()
16th Mar 2018, 5:28 PM
Baraa AB
Baraa AB - avatar